The Manager Insights tab (within the Insights module) provides a dashboard for managers to easily view their team's performance and activity in Betterworks. By extension, Manager Insights helps managers guide their teams for better performance at an individual level and at a team level.

  • Dashboard: Our dashboard includes 13 metrics. These metrics allow managers to understand their team's behavior as well as potential growth so that they can motivate team members as needed.

  • Timeframe: Managers can switch quarters or enter a custom date range. 

  • Filters: There are filters at the department, manager, and individual levels as well as a filter for conversation names. 

clip.png

  • Drill-down functionality: Managers can click on any card in the dashboard and view more
    details.
  • Take Actions: Managers can also take actions (i.e. "View" or "Send email") to a particular employee from the drill-down page.

    Note: The "Send email" function opens your email client. These notifications do not go through the Betterworks application.

Note:

  • If a direct report's conversations contain additional contributors, the additional contributors' completion will impact the direct report's overall conversation completion rate. This means that if the direct report and manager complete their respective sides of a conversation, but the additional contributors do not, the conversation status will indicate that the conversation is incomplete and the direct report's overall conversation completion rate will decrease. Also, if a direct report is an additional contributor, the conversation that they are contributing to will be displayed among their conversations in the "View" overlay.
  • If "confirm meeting" is enabled in your conversation cycle, the individual conversation completion percentage will reach 100% once the meeting has been confirmed by either participant (direct report or manager). This occurs even if one participant has not yet shared responses, as it is assumed that all necessary discussions have taken place, and the conversation is marked as complete regardless of any outstanding tasks.

Settings & Access

Once Manager Insights has been enabled for your organization, administrators can determine the specific dashboard settings and benchmarks that will appear. Administrators can update these dashboard settings by going to:

Admin → Program Management → Manager Insights v2 → Settings

Managers will only be able to see data on their immediate teams and cannot search for or view data on employees in their downline. Top-level leaders are able to view data for both their direct reports and any employee that falls in their downline.

Metric Details

  • Usage in the past [#] days

usage.png

    • Represents the total percentage of employees that have accessed Betterworks in the past [#] days.
    • The maximum and minimum values can be 100% and 0%, respectively.
    • If you go back to a past date range, the metric becomes irrelevant and will display "N/A.
    • The default value is 14, but can be changed by an administrator in the Admin module.
    • Score = (# of employees who have updated or logged into Betterworks) * 100 / (Total # of employees with the applied filter and the respective scope).

  • Owns at least [#] goals

owns_goals.png

    • Represents the percentage of employees in scope who own at least [#] goal(s).
    • The maximum and minimum values can be 100% and 0%, respectively.
    • The default value is 3, but can be changed by an administrator in the Admin module.
    • Score = (# of employees who have created at least [#] goals) * 100 / (Total # of employees with the applied filter and the respective scope).
  • Updates to goals in the last [#] days

goal_updates.png

    • Represents the percentage of employees in scope who have updated their goal(s) in the past [#] days.
    • The maximum and minimum values can be 100% and 0%, respectively.
    • The default value is 14, but can be changed by an administrator in the Admin module.
    • Score = (# of employees who have updated their goals in the past [#] days) * 100 / (Total # of employees with the applied filter and the respective scope).

  • Owns at least [#] aligned goals

aligned_goals.png

    • Represents the percentage of employees in scope who own at least [#] goals with alignment.

    • The maximum and minimum values can be 100% and 0%, respectively.

    • The default value is 3, but can be changed by an administrator in the Admin module.

    • Score = (# of employees within the applied view who own >= [#] goal(s) with alignment) / (Total # of employees in the applied view).

  • Owns at least [#] milestones

own_milestones.png

    • Represents the percentage of employees in scope who own at least [#] milestone(s).
    • The maximum and minimum values can be 100% and 0%, respectively.
    • The default value is 5, but can be changed by an administrator in the Admin module.
    • Score = (# of employees who have created at least [#] milestones) * 100 / (Total # of employees with the applied filter and the respective scope).

  • Updates to milestones in the last [#] days

milestone_updates.png

    • Represents the percentage of employees in scope who have updated their milestone(s) in the past [#] days.
    • The maximum and minimum values can be 100% and 0%, respectively.
    • The default value is 14, but can be changed by an administrator in the Admin module.
    • Score = (# of employees who have updated their milestones in the past [#] days) * 100 / (Total # of employees with the applied filter and the respective scope).
  • Average feedback and recognition received

feedback_rec_received.png

    • Represents the average # of feedback and recognition received per employee in the selected view for the given business period.
    • The default value is 5, but can be changed by an administrator in the Admin module.
    • Score = (# of feedback and recognition received by employees in selected view in a business period) / (Total # of employees in the selected view).
  • Average feedback and recognition provided

feedback_rec_provided.png

    • Represents the average # of feedback and recognition provided per employee in the selected view for the given business period.
    • The default value is 5, but can be changed by an administrator in the Admin module.
    • Score = (# of feedback and recognition provided by employees in selected view in a business period) / (Total # of employees in the selected view).
  • Average feedback and recognition received from other teams

feedback_rec_received_other_teams.png

    • Represents the average # of feedback and recognition received per employee not in the selected view for the given business period.
    • The default value is 2, but can be changed by an administrator in the Admin module.
    • Score = (# of feedback and recognition received by employees not in selected view in a business period) / (Total # of employees in the selected view).
  • Average feedback and recognition provided to other teams

feedback_rec_provided_other_teams.png

    • Represents the average # of feedback and recognition provided per employee not in selected view for the given business period.
    • The default value is 2, but can be changed by an administrator in the Admin module.
    • Score = (# of feedback and recognition provided by employees not in selected view in a business period) / (Total # of employees in selected view).

  • Average feedback requested

feedback_requested.png

    • Represents the # of feedback requested by employees in scope during the current business period.
    • The default value is 3, but can be changed by an administrator in the Admin module.
    • Score = (# of feedback requested by employees in selected view in a business period) / (Total # of employees in selected view).

  • Feedback completion rate

feedback_completion.png

    • Represents the percentage of feedback requests that have been completed by employees within the selected view.
    • The default value is 100%, but can be changed by an administrator in the Admin module.
    • Score = (# of completed feedback requests for employees in selected view) / (Total # of feedback requests received for employees in selected view).

  • Completed conversation

conversations.png

    • Represents the percentage of active conversations that employees in scope have completed.
    • The default value is 100%, but can be changed by an administrator in the Admin module.
    • Score = (# of completed conversations for employees in scope) / (Total # of active conversations for employees in scope).

FAQs

Are confidential questions visible to everyone? 

When conversations between managers and direct reports contain confidential questions, they will only be visible to Super and HR Admins since confidential questions aren’t visible to managers.

  • When a manager filters and drills into information for a specific conversation that contains confidential questions in Manager Insights, and both parties have shared their answers but the completion isn’t 100%, this is because the direct report hasn’t completed the confidential questions; completion rates display % completion based on if confidential questions have been completed.
  • When drilling into the information you may see that even if both parties have shared, UI completion doesn’t reflect 100% because managers can only drive completion of what is visible to them.
